Day 1,325: Trump plays golf for 13th straight week after thanking 0.0036% of veterans for supporting him
In a desperate effort to push back against the torrent of negative press surrounding Donald Trump’s frequent calling of military service members “suckers” and “losers,” Trump and his team are grasping at straws.
Late Friday, Trump touted a Breitbart article that noted “about 674 veterans” wrote a letter in support of Trump. With about 19 million veterans in the country, Trump is gleefully sharing a letter signed by 0.0036% of the total number of veterans in the country.
For perspective, that would be like saying the 12,000-person population of Clawson, Michigan or 15% of AT&T Stadium, where the Dallas Cowboys play, is representative of the entire U.S.
Saturday, trying to ignore the continuing uproar, and apparently finding nothing to do on a pandemic that has killed 188,000 Americans, Trump played golf for the 13th straight week.
Trump continues to keep high his absurd rate of visiting his golf properties, which currently stands at over 22% of his days in office. Taking into account all of his properties, Trump has been at a property with his name slapped on the building on over 30% of his days in office.
